Ice crystallisation in crosslinked dextran (Sephadex) gels was studied by the method of two-dimensional X-ray diffraction (XRD) in combination with the simultaneous measurement of differential scanning calorimetry (DSC). With a Sephadex G25 gel where an exotherm due to ice crystallisation is observed in the DSC rewarming trace, it was indicated by the XRD pattern that small ice crystals less than approximately 10 microns in diameter are readily formed during freezing, and that the endothermic trend prior to the exotherm is not due to the glass transition but due to the melting of the small ice crystals. Moreover, the diffraction pattern observed with frozen Sephadex gels depended on the density of crosslink indicating that ice crystals of different size and dimension are formed in the gels.
